Common Window Issues in Aylesbury

Homeowners in Aylesbury often experience a series of window problems, from small repairs to significant replacements. Here are some of the most typical issues:

  1. Cracked or Broken Glass: This is among the most frequent issues, often triggered by accidental effects or severe weather.
  2. Leaky Windows: Water leakages around windows can lead to wetness, mold, and damage to the surrounding walls and frames.
  3. Sticky or Hard to Open/Close windows aylesbury: Over time, windows can end up being hard to run due to wear and tear, deforming, or build-up of dirt.
  4. Drafty Windows: Gaps in the window seals can trigger drafts, leading to energy loss and discomfort.
  5. Damaged or Rotten Frames: Wooden frames are especially susceptible to rot and decay, which can jeopardize the structural integrity of the window.
  6. Condensation: Moisture accumulation between double-glazed windows can indicate an unsuccessful seal, decreasing the window's insulating properties.

How to Identify Window Problems

Early detection of window problems can save property owners both money and time. Here are some indications to watch out for:

  • Visible Damage: Cracks, chips, or broken glass are obvious indicators that your windows need attention.
  • Drafts: Feeling a cold draft near your windows throughout the winter season or discovering warm air getting away in the summer signifies a bad seal.
  • Water Leaks: Puddles or damp spots around window frames after rain can suggest leakages.
  • Problem in Operation: If you find it tough to open or close your windows, they may need modification or repair.
  • Unusual Noises: Creaking or squeaking noises when opening or closing windows can be an indication of wear and tear.
  • Foggy or Cloudy Windows: Condensation inside double-glazed windows suggests a failed seal.

FAQs About Window Repairs in Aylesbury

Q: How much does window repair expense in aylesbury windows and doors?

  • A: The cost of window repair can vary depending on the extent of the damage and the type of window. Small repairs, such as replacing a small pane of glass, can cost in between ₤ 50 and ₤ 150. More intricate repairs, like changing a frame or a double-glazed unit, can range from ₤ 200 to ₤ 500 or more.

Q: Can I repair a double-glazed window myself?

  • A: While some minor repairs can be done DIY, such as replacing a single pane, repairing a double-glazed unit is usually a job for specialists. The process includes getting rid of the old unit, cleaning the frame, and installing a brand-new unit, which needs specialized tools and skills.

Q: How long does a window repair usually take?

  • A: The period of a window repair depends upon the intricacy of the problem. Simple repairs can be finished in a couple of hours, while more comprehensive repairs or replacements might take a day or more.

Q: Are window repair aylesbury repairs covered by home insurance?

  • A: Many home insurance coverage cover window repairs if the damage was brought on by a covered event, such as a storm or a burglary. However, it's important to check your policy and contact your insurance coverage company to validate coverage.

Q: What can I do to prevent future window problems?

  • A: Regular upkeep can help avoid future window concerns. This consists of cleaning up the windows, examining and tightening hardware, and sealing any spaces or fractures. In addition, consider upgrading to energy-efficient windows if your present ones are old or inefficient.

Tips for Maintaining Your Windows

To ensure your windows last longer and work better, here are some maintenance suggestions:

  • Regular Cleaning: Clean your windows a minimum of two times a year to eliminate dirt and particles that can build up and cause damage.
  • Examine Seals: Check the seals around your windows for signs of wear and tear. Replace any broken seals to prevent drafts and leaks.
  • Lube Moving Parts: Lubricate the hinges and locks of your windows to keep them operating efficiently.
  • Cut Surrounding Plants: Keep trees and shrubs cut to avoid branches from harming your windows.
  • Display for Signs of Rot: If you have wood frames, frequently check them for indications of rot and treat them with a wood preservative as needed.
